Septic system rep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ues within an existing septic system to ensure it functions properly. This process typically includes inspecting the septic tank, drain field, and associated components to identify any damage, blockages, or wear that could be causing problems. Repair work may involve replacing damaged pipes, fixing leaks, or restoring the integrity of the septic tank and drain field. These services are essential for maintaining a reliable wastewater management system, helping to prevent backups, odors, and other sanitation issues that can affect the property’s livability.

Many common problems signal the need for septic system repairs. Homeowners might notice persistent foul odors around the property, slow-draining sinks and toilets, or standing water in the yard near the septic area. Other signs include sewage backups in the plumbing fixtures or lush, overly green patches in the lawn where the drain field is located. These issues often indicate that the septic system is failing or has sustained damage, requiring professional intervention to restore proper operation and prevent more serious complications.

Septic system repair services are typically used on residential properties that rely on septic tanks for wastewater treatment. This includes homes in rural or semi-rural areas where municipal sewer lines are not available. Properties with larger families or higher water usage may also need repairs more frequently due to increased stress on the system. Additionally, older properties with outdated septic components or those that have experienced ground shifting, tree root intrusion, or heavy equipment activity often require repair work to keep the system functioning efficiently.

The overview below groups typical Septic System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Oakley,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ine repairs like fixing leaks or replacing a damaged pipe generally range from $250-$600. Many common repair jobs fall within this middle range, making them the most frequent project size for local pros in Oakley, CA.

Septic Tank Pumping - Regular septic tank pumping services usually cost between $300 and $500, depending on tank size and accessibility. Most homeowners in the area can expect to pay within this range for routine maintenance visits.

Full System Replacement - Replacing an entire septic system can cost from $3,500 to over $7,000, with larger or more complex projects reaching higher prices. These are less common but necessary for systems that have reached the end of their lifespan or are severely damaged.

Emergency Repairs - Emergency septic repairs, often needed for urgent issues like sewage backups, typically cost between $1,000 and $5,000+. Many urgent jobs fall into the $1,500-$3,000 range, but more extensive emergencies can push costs higher depending on the scope of work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a septic system needs repair? Signs include slow draining fixtures, foul odors around the system, standing water or lush patches over the drain field, and backups in toilets or sinks.

How can local contractors help with septic system repairs? They can diagnose issues, perform necessary repairs or replacements, and ensure the system functions properly to prevent future problems.

What types of septic system repairs do service providers typically handle? Repairs may include fixing leaks, replacing damaged pipes, repairing or replacing the drain field, and addressing system clogs or failures.

Are there preventative measures to avoid septic system issues? Regular inspections, proper waste disposal, and avoiding the use of harsh chemicals can help maintain system health and reduce repair needs.
